Oxfordshire beauty spot saved from becoming a waste coal ash dump
Ecologist
21st January, 2009
It has been a long and bitter struggle. When locals who had for years enjoyed the peace and tranquillity of Thrupp lake at Radley, Oxfordshire, learned that it was to be filled with fly-ash from Didcot power station, they assumed that a small but vocal protest would help see off the plans. more...
